Midweek racing takes place at Northam on Wednesday as the days count down to the return to Ascot for the Perth summer racing carnival.

We have eight races in the Avon Valley today, where the track is rated a Good 4 and the rail is out 6m.

Tim Geers has previewed every race on today’s card with his best bet coming up in Race 5 and his best value bet in Race 2.

(3) Serviceman has only raced once but that was an eye-catching effort when finishing off strongly behind Hoi An, who then went on to win the Gimcrack and the Sires’ Produce at Group 3 level. Looks a very good form reference for a maiden at Northam, but this is a deep race.

(10) Snip Of Glory trialled really well at her most recent effort and she looks ready for the races now. The draw in barrier 9 isn’t an easy one for Patrick Carbery but she found the line strongly under very little pressure in her trial and if she can get a tow into the race, she’ll get her chance to run over the top of her rivals.

(2) Justamiddy is racing very well without much luck this prep. Should get an ideal run from barrier 2 and looks a decent each way bet at $7.50.

(6) Real Danger was about $3.340 into $2.10 last start, sat three-wide the trip and went down by half-a-length. Obviously has strong claims.
